Across TCGA patient cohorts, STARD3 RNA expression is significantly associated with the protein abundance of many other proteins, with 7,486 significant associations in total. LSCC shows the largest number of these associations.

The most reproducible STARD3-associated proteins across cancer lineages are DHX8, GMPPA, and MED1. Each is linked with STARD3 in more than 4 cancer types. Because this analysis shows association rather than direction, both STARD3-to-partner and partner-to-STARD3 results are reported.

Each partner links to its own Q-omics profile. The scatter plot shows the strongest example, STARD3 versus DHX8 in COAD, with a Pearson correlation of 0.38.
